Output d5df6e2dfd8bc2e635d47a42340a89d70da1df1d5ecc18249e9f599998d6c77d:5

value
24915000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f35cd673bb813a45bfd70e412d101509de OP_EQUAL
address
3BMEX6JVGqHQQTPDAMuHtvwrWNrJJ2VLFw
transaction
d5df6e2dfd8bc2e635d47a42340a89d70da1df1d5ecc18249e9f599998d6c77d
confirmations
397374
spent
true